Discover the hidden gem of Bishkek, the expansive Botanical Garden, a serene oasis that stands as one of the city's most enchanting treasures. Named in honor of the renowned Kyrgyz biologist Gareev, this lush paradise is a testament to nature's marvels and human ingenuity. Established in 1938, the Botanical Garden proudly claims its place as one of Central Asia's largest and most diverse collections, an essential part of the National Academy of Sciences. Within its sprawling 124 hectares, a symphony of botanical wonders unfolds. Encounter over 2,500 tree and shrub species, 3,500 flower varieties, and a dazzling array of greenhouse plants. Remarkably, the garden houses over 8,000 species of fruit-bearing plants, a testament to Kyrgyzstan's rich agricultural heritage. As you explore, you'll discover 4 cutting-edge research laboratories dedicated to expanding our understanding of the botanical world. Journey through the Seasons in this captivating haven. In spring, the air is infused with the fragrance of blossoms and the vitality of new leaves. During autumn, a painterly display of golden yellows and fiery reds create a living canvas.
